Output 634b7a2395943f617d128cc15fd8c6d606107629eb4a5c53617f3f6541c34251:1

value
979676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f7b534efeeb3da4ad7e581af684b2959a69eac2 OP_EQUAL
address
3GEH6qzSztdMoG4qPbGyhdDvHhsbFhGF5G
transaction
634b7a2395943f617d128cc15fd8c6d606107629eb4a5c53617f3f6541c34251
spent
true